TWO years out from the next Rugby World Cup, the bookies have the Springboks as hot favourites to defend their title once more, but that will not mean coach Rassie Erasmus will be holding thumbs when the pool draw is made in Sydney at 11am today.

- BY MIKE GREENAWAY

The five teams the Boks cannot be drawn against are fellow Band 1 members, thanks to their finish on the 2025 World Rugby Rankings: New Zealand, England, Ireland, France and Argentina. Teams fill into the six pools as each round of draws is made under each pool leader.
